DTC B2286: Runnable Signal Malfunction; DTC P0335: Crankshaft Position Sensor "A" Circuit: Procedure

  1. CHECK HARNESS AND CONNECTOR (BATTERY - POWER MANAGEMENT CONTROL ECU) See step   1 

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R (BATTERY - POWER MANAGEMENT CONTROL ECU) 

    OK: Go to next step 

  2. CHECK HARNESS AND CONNECTOR (POWER MANAGEMENT CONTROL ECU - BODY GROUND) See step   2 

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R (POWER MANAGEMENT CONTROL ECU - BODY GROUND) 

    OK: Go to next step 

  3. CHECK HARNESS AND CONNECTOR (POWER MANAGEMENT CONTROL ECU - ECM) 
    1. Disconnect the A41 connector from the ECM.
      Fig 1: Power Management Control ECU - ECM Connector Terminal Identification
      GTY294165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    2.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      D42-4 (NE) - A41-7 (NEO)*1
      D42-4 (NE) - A49-53 (NEO)*2
      Always Below 1 Ω
      D42-4 (NE) - Body ground Always 10 kΩ or higher
      • *1: for 2GR-FE
      • *2: for 1AR-FE
      TEXT IN ILLUSTRATION

      *a Front view of wire harness connector
      (to Power Management Control ECU)
      *b Front view of wire harness connector
      (to ECM)
      *A for 2ZR-FE *B for 1AR-FE

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R (POWER MANAGEMENT CONTROL ECU - ECM) 

    OK: Go to next step 

  4. READ VALUE USING TECHSTREAM 
    1. Connect the Techstream to the DLC3.
    2. Turn the engine switch on (IG).
    3. Turn the Techstream on.
    4. Enter the following menus: Body Electrical / Power Source Control / Data List.
    5. Read the Data List according to the value(s) in the Techstream.
      POWER SOURCE CONTROL

      Tester Display Measurement Item/Range Normal Condition Diagnostic Note
      Engine Condition Engine condition/Stop or Run Stop: Engine stopped
      Run: Engine running
      -

      OK

      Stop (engine is stopped) and Run (steering lock is locked) appear on the screen.

    NG → GO TO SFI SYSTEM 

    OK: Go to next step 

  5. CHECK POWER MANAGEMENT CONTROL ECU 
    1. Reconnect the D42 connector to the power management control ECU.
      Fig 2: Inspecting D42 Power Management Control ECU Connector Terminals
      GTY250045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    2. Reconnect the A41 connector to the ECM.
    3. Connect an D42-4 (NE) and body ground.
    4. Check for pulses according to the condition(s) in the table below.

      OK

      Tester Connection Condition Specified Condition
      D42-4 (NE) - Body ground Engine is stopped No pulse generated
      Engine is running Pulse generated (1000 rpm: 200 Hz)
      TEXT IN ILLUSTRATION

      *1 Component with harness connected
      (Power Management Control ECU)

    NG → GO TO SFI SYSTEM 

    OK → See step   6 

  6. REPLACE POWER MANAGEMENT CONTROL ECU. Refer to  REMOVAL
